A case study about joining databases for the assessment of exposures to noise and ototoxic substances in occupational settings

HIGHLIGHTS

  • who: Fru00e9du00e9ric Clerc and Benoit Pouyatos from the Institute for the Prevention of Accidents and Diseases (INRS), Rue du Morvan have published the Article: A Case Study about Joining Databases for the Assessment of Exposures to Noise and Ototoxic Substances in Occupational Settings, in the Journal: (JOURNAL)
  • what: This analysis shows that the rate of hearing loss in these sectors is high but does not show an increased incidence of hearing loss in co-exposed sectors. The major reason for this is probably related to the under-declaration of occupational hearing loss: In observational data . . .
